#!/usr/bin/env python3
|
||||
"""
|
||||
Analyze Claude Code conversation history to identify patterns and common mistakes.
|
||||
"""
|
||||
|
||||
import json
|
||||
import re
|
||||
from collections import Counter, defaultdict
|
||||
from datetime import datetime
|
||||
from pathlib import Path
|
||||
|
||||
def load_history(history_path):
|
||||
"""Load and parse history.jsonl file."""
|
||||
conversations = []
|
||||
with open(history_path, 'r') as f:
|
||||
for line in f:
|
||||
try:
|
||||
conversations.append(json.loads(line))
|
||||
except json.JSONDecodeError:
|
||||
continue
|
||||
return conversations
|
||||
|
||||
def extract_patterns(conversations):
|
||||
"""Extract patterns from conversations."""
|
||||
patterns = {
|
||||
'common_tasks': Counter(),
|
||||
'projects': Counter(),
|
||||
'error_keywords': Counter(),
|
||||
'request_types': Counter(),
|
||||
'time_distribution': defaultdict(int),
|
||||
'complexity_indicators': Counter(),
|
||||
}
|
||||
|
||||
error_keywords = ['error', 'fix', 'bug', 'issue', 'problem', 'fail', 'broken', 'wrong', 'incorrect', 'merge conflict']
|
||||
complexity_indicators = ['refactor', 'implement', 'add feature', 'create', 'build', 'migrate', 'optimize', 'analyze']
|
||||
|
||||
for conv in conversations:
|
||||
display = conv.get('display', '').lower()
|
||||
project = conv.get('project', '')
|
||||
|
||||
# Count projects
|
||||
if project:
|
||||
patterns['projects'][project] += 1
|
||||
|
||||
# Count error-related requests
|
||||
for keyword in error_keywords:
|
||||
if keyword in display:
|
||||
patterns['error_keywords'][keyword] += 1
|
||||
|
||||
# Count complexity indicators
|
||||
for indicator in complexity_indicators:
|
||||
if indicator in display:
|
||||
patterns['complexity_indicators'][indicator] += 1
|
||||
|
||||
# Categorize request types
|
||||
if any(kw in display for kw in ['fix', 'error', 'bug', 'issue', 'problem']):
|
||||
patterns['request_types']['bug_fix'] += 1
|
||||
elif any(kw in display for kw in ['add', 'create', 'implement', 'build', 'new']):
|
||||
patterns['request_types']['feature_addition'] += 1
|
||||
elif any(kw in display for kw in ['refactor', 'improve', 'optimize', 'clean']):
|
||||
patterns['request_types']['refactoring'] += 1
|
||||
elif any(kw in display for kw in ['explain', 'what', 'how', 'why', 'analyze', 'understand']):
|
||||
patterns['request_types']['information_query'] += 1
|
||||
elif any(kw in display for kw in ['test', 'run', 'build', 'deploy']):
|
||||
patterns['request_types']['testing_deployment'] += 1
|
||||
else:
|
||||
patterns['request_types']['other'] += 1
|
||||
|
||||
# Time distribution (hour of day)
|
||||
if 'timestamp' in conv:
|
||||
dt = datetime.fromtimestamp(conv['timestamp'] / 1000)
|
||||
hour = dt.hour
|
||||
patterns['time_distribution'][hour] += 1
|
||||
|
||||
# Track all tasks
|
||||
patterns['common_tasks'][display] += 1
|
||||
|
||||
return patterns
|
||||
|
||||
def identify_common_mistakes(conversations):
|
||||
"""Identify patterns that might indicate common mistakes."""
|
||||
mistakes = {
|
||||
'repeated_fixes': [],
|
||||
'merge_conflicts': [],
|
||||
'repeated_requests': [],
|
||||
'vague_requests': [],
|
||||
'multi_step_without_planning': [],
|
||||
}
|
||||
|
||||
# Track repeated similar requests
|
||||
task_groups = defaultdict(list)
|
||||
for i, conv in enumerate(conversations):
|
||||
display = conv.get('display', '')
|
||||
|
||||
# Group similar tasks
|
||||
normalized = re.sub(r'\d+', '#', display.lower())
|
||||
normalized = re.sub(r'[^\w\s]', '', normalized)
|
||||
task_groups[normalized].append((i, display, conv))
|
||||
|
||||
# Identify repeated fixes
|
||||
for task, occurrences in task_groups.items():
|
||||
if len(occurrences) > 2 and any(kw in task for kw in ['fix', 'error', 'bug']):
|
||||
mistakes['repeated_fixes'].append({
|
||||
'pattern': task,
|
||||
'count': len(occurrences),
|
||||
'examples': [occ[1] for occ in occurrences[:3]]
|
||||
})
|
||||
|
||||
# Identify merge conflicts
|
||||
for conv in conversations:
|
||||
display = conv.get('display', '')
|
||||
if 'merge conflict' in display.lower():
|
||||
mistakes['merge_conflicts'].append(display)
|
||||
|
||||
# Identify repeated requests (exact matches)
|
||||
for task, occurrences in task_groups.items():
|
||||
if len(occurrences) > 3:
|
||||
mistakes['repeated_requests'].append({
|
||||
'pattern': occurrences[0][1],
|
||||
'count': len(occurrences)
|
||||
})
|
||||
|
||||
# Identify vague requests (very short or unclear)
|
||||
vague_keywords = ['this', 'that', 'it', 'the thing', 'stuff']
|
||||
for conv in conversations:
|
||||
display = conv.get('display', '')
|
||||
if len(display.split()) < 4 or any(vk in display.lower() for vk in vague_keywords):
|
||||
if len(display) < 30:
|
||||
mistakes['vague_requests'].append(display)
|
||||
|
||||
# Identify complex multi-step requests
|
||||
multi_step_indicators = [' and ', ', ', 'then ', 'also ', 'plus ']
|
||||
for conv in conversations:
|
||||
display = conv.get('display', '')
|
||||
if sum(indicator in display.lower() for indicator in multi_step_indicators) >= 2:
|
||||
mistakes['multi_step_without_planning'].append(display)
|
||||
|
||||
return mistakes
